Wayne Township, Darke County, Ohio
==Geography== Located in the northeastern part of the county, it borders the following townships: The village of Versailles is located in central Wayne Township, and the unincorporated community of Frenchtown lies in the township`s northwest. ==Name and history== It is one of twenty Wayne Townships...
